Effizienz und Kompaktheit für Ihre Mikrocontroller-Projekte: Der PIC 12F1501-E/SN
Suchen Sie nach einer kostengünstigen und leistungsfähigen Lösung für Ihre Embedded-System-Anforderungen? Der PIC 12F1501-E/SN – ein 8-Bit-PICmicro Mikrocontroller mit 1,75 KB Speicher und einer Taktfrequenz von 20 MHz im SO-8 Gehäuse – ist die ideale Wahl für Entwickler, die Präzision und Zuverlässigkeit in kompakten Designs benötigen. Dieses Bauteil eignet sich hervorragend für eine Vielzahl von Steuerungsaufgaben, von einfachen Sensorabfragen bis hin zur Steuerung kleiner Motoren und Anzeigen, und bietet eine signifikante Verbesserung gegenüber herkömmlichen Lösungen durch seine integrierten Peripherien und optimierte Architektur.
Leistung und Vielseitigkeit im Kleinstformat
Der PIC 12F1501-E/SN repräsentiert die nächste Generation von PICmicro Mikrocontrollern, optimiert für Anwendungen, bei denen Platz und Energieeffizienz von entscheidender Bedeutung sind. Seine 8-Bit-Architektur ermöglicht eine effiziente Datenverarbeitung für eine breite Palette von Steuerungs- und Überwachungsaufgaben. Mit einer Taktfrequenz von bis zu 20 MHz bietet dieser Mikrocontroller ausreichende Rechenleistung für anspruchsvolle Echtzeitanwendungen, ohne dabei unnötig Energie zu verbrauchen. Das SO-8 Gehäuse ist dabei ein entscheidender Vorteil für Designs mit begrenztem Platzangebot auf der Leiterplatte.
Schlüsselvorteile des PIC 12F1501-E/SN
- Kompakte Bauform: Das SO-8 Gehäuse minimiert den Platzbedarf auf der Leiterplatte, was ihn ideal für portable Geräte und platzbeschränkte Designs macht.
- Energieeffizienz: Optimierte Architektur und Low-Power-Modi reduzieren den Stromverbrauch, entscheidend für batteriebetriebene Anwendungen.
- Integrierte Peripherien: Umfangreiche Peripheriefunktionen wie Analog-Digital-Wandler (ADC), Pulsweitenmodulation (PWM) und serielle Kommunikationsschnittstellen (UART/SPI/I2C) reduzieren die Notwendigkeit externer Komponenten.
- Hohe Taktfrequenz: Mit 20 MHz bietet er genügend Verarbeitungsleistung für viele Steuerungs- und Regelungsaufgaben.
- Kosteneffizienz: Ein attraktives Preis-Leistungs-Verhältnis macht ihn zur wirtschaftlichen Wahl für Massenproduktionen und Prototypen.
- Robuste Leistung: Die bewährte PICmicro-Architektur von Microchip Technology steht für Zuverlässigkeit und Langlebigkeit in industriellen Umgebungen.
- Erweiterte Speicherkapazität: 1,75 KB Flash-Speicher bieten ausreichend Platz für Firmware und Daten, um komplexe Logik zu implementieren.
Technische Spezifikationen im Detail
Die technische Ausgestaltung des PIC 12F1501-E/SN ist darauf ausgelegt, maximale Funktionalität in minimalem Raum zu vereinen. Die 8-Bit-CPU, gepaart mit einer 20 MHz Taktfrequenz, ermöglicht eine schnelle Ausführung von Befehlen und macht ihn zu einem leistungsstarken Kandidaten für diverse Steuerungsapplikationen. Der verfügbare Flash-Speicher von 1,75 KB ist ausreichend für eine Vielzahl von Firmware-Implementierungen, von einfachen Steuerungsalgorithmen bis hin zu komplexeren Logiken mit Datenverarbeitung.
Integrierte Peripherien für erweiterte Funktionalität
Ein herausragendes Merkmal des PIC 12F1501-E/SN sind seine integrierten Peripherie-Module, die die Komplexität und Kosten von Designs erheblich reduzieren. Dazu gehören:
- Analog-Digital-Wandler (ADC): Ermöglicht die präzise Erfassung von analogen Signalen aus Sensoren. Die Auflösung und Abtastrate sind optimiert für typische Messaufgaben.
- Pulsweitenmodulation (PWM): Ideal für die Steuerung von Motoren, Helligkeit von LEDs oder die Erzeugung von analogen Spannungen aus digitalen Signalen.
- Serielle Kommunikationsschnittstellen: Unterstützung für Standards wie UART, SPI und I2C ermöglicht die nahtlose Integration mit anderen Mikrocontrollern, Sensoren und Kommunikationsmodulen. Dies vereinfacht die Datenerfassung und die Vernetzung von Geräten.
- Timer/Zähler: Vielseitige Timer-Module sind für Zeitmessungen, Ereigniszählungen und die Generierung von Zeitbasissignalen unverzichtbar.
- Watchdog-Timer (WDT): Bietet eine zusätzliche Sicherheitsebene, indem er das System im Falle eines Softwareabsturzes neu startet.
Diese integrierten Funktionen reduzieren die Notwendigkeit für externe Komponenten, was zu kleineren Platinenlayouts, geringeren Stücklistenkosten und erhöhter Systemzuverlässigkeit führt. Die flexible Konfigurierbarkeit der Peripherien durch Software erlaubt eine Anpassung an spezifische Anwendungsanforderungen.
Anwendungsbereiche und Einsatzszenarien
Der PIC 12F1501-E/SN ist prädestiniert für eine breite Palette von Anwendungen, insbesondere dort, wo Kompaktheit und Kosteneffizienz im Vordergrund stehen. Dazu zählen:
- Haushaltsgeräte: Steuerung von Funktionen in kleinen Haushaltsgeräten wie Toastern, Kaffeemaschinen oder Lüftern.
- Industrielle Automatisierung: Einfache Steuerungsaufgaben, Sensorüberwachung und Aktuatoransteuerung in industriellen Umgebungen.
- Automobilanwendungen: Steuerungsfunktionen in Komfortsystemen, Innenbeleuchtung oder Fenstersystemen.
- Konsumerelektronik: Steuerung von Funktionen in kleinen elektronischen Geräten, Spielzeug oder Zubehör.
- Medizintechnik: Einfache Steuerungsaufgaben in Diagnosegeräten oder medizinischen Hilfsmitteln.
- IoT-Anwendungen: Als zentrale Steuereinheit in Sensorknoten oder kleinen IoT-Geräten, die eine begrenzte Rechenleistung benötigen.
Die Fähigkeit, komplexe Logik in einem kleinen Paket zu verarbeiten, macht ihn zu einem Eckpfeiler moderner Embedded-System-Entwicklung. Die breite Akzeptanz der PICmicro-Architektur und die Verfügbarkeit von Entwicklungsressourcen von Microchip Technology gewährleisten eine schnelle und erfolgreiche Implementierung.
Produkteigenschaften im Überblick
| Merkmal | Spezifikation |
|---|---|
| Hersteller | Microchip Technology |
| Mikrocontroller Familie | PIC 12-Bit |
| Architektur | 8-Bit PICmicro |
| Kernprozessor | PIC |
| Maximale Taktfrequenz | 20 MHz |
| Flash-Speichergröße | 1.75 KB (1792 Bytes) |
| RAM-Speichergröße | 128 Bytes |
| Gehäuse | SO-8 |
| Betriebstemperaturbereich | -40°C bis +85°C |
| E/A-Pins | 6 |
| Betriebsspannung | 1.8V bis 3.6V |
| Integrierte Peripherien | ADC, PWM, UART, SPI, I2C, Timer, WDT |
| Anzahl Timer | 2 (8-Bit und 16-Bit) |
FAQ – Häufig gestellte Fragen zu PIC 12F1501-E/SN – 8-Bit-PICmicro Mikrocontroller, 1,75 KB, 20 MHz, SO-8
Was ist die Hauptanwendung für den PIC 12F1501-E/SN?
Der PIC 12F1501-E/SN eignet sich hervorragend für kostengünstige Steuerungs- und Überwachungsaufgaben in einer Vielzahl von Anwendungen, bei denen geringer Platzbedarf und Energieeffizienz wichtig sind, wie z.B. in kleinen Haushaltsgeräten, Konsumgütern oder IoT-Sensorknoten.
Ist der PIC 12F1501-E/SN für Anfänger im Bereich Mikrocontroller geeignet?
Ja, dank der breiten Verfügbarkeit von Dokumentation, Beispielen und Entwicklungswerkzeugen von Microchip Technology ist der PIC 12F1501-E/SN auch für Einsteiger gut zugänglich, insbesondere wenn sie bereits mit der grundlegenden Funktionsweise von Mikrocontrollern vertraut sind.
Welche Entwicklungsumgebung wird für diesen Mikrocontroller empfohlen?
Microchip Technology empfiehlt die Verwendung der MPLAB X Integrated Development Environment (IDE) in Kombination mit dem XC8 Compiler für die Entwicklung mit dem PIC 12F1501-E/SN. Diese Tools bieten eine umfassende Entwicklungsumgebung für Code-Entwicklung, Debugging und Programmierung.
Wie kann die Energieeffizienz des PIC 12F1501-E/SN optimiert werden?
Die Energieeffizienz kann durch die Nutzung von Sleep-Modi, die präzise Konfiguration der Taktfrequenz und das Abschalten nicht benötigter Peripherien optimiert werden. Der integrierte Watchdog-Timer kann ebenfalls zur effizienten Wiederaufnahme des Betriebs nach niedrigem Energieverbrauch beitragen.
Welche Art von Sensoren können mit dem integrierten ADC des PIC 12F1501-E/SN ausgelesen werden?
Der integrierte Analog-Digital-Wandler (ADC) eignet sich zum Auslesen einer Vielzahl von analogen Sensoren, wie z.B. Temperatursensoren (Thermistor, Thermoelement-Konditionierung), Lichtsensoren (Fotowiderstände), Drucksensoren oder Spannungsteiler, die analoge Signale liefern.
Bietet das SO-8 Gehäuse Einschränkungen bei der Wärmeableitung im Vergleich zu größeren Gehäusen?
Das SO-8 Gehäuse ist für die typischen Leistungsanforderungen des PIC 12F1501-E/SN bei den spezifizierten Betriebsbedingungen ausreichend dimensioniert. Für Anwendungen mit extrem hoher Last oder unter widrigen thermischen Bedingungen sollten jedoch die spezifischen thermischen Spezifikationen des Bauteils und das Systemdesign berücksichtigt werden.
Ist dieser Mikrocontroller für den Einsatz in sicherheitskritischen Systemen geeignet?
Der PIC 12F1501-E/SN ist ein Allzweck-Mikrocontroller und nicht speziell für sicherheitskritische Anwendungen (z.B. nach ISO 26262 oder SIL-Zertifizierung) konzipiert. Für solche Anwendungen sind spezialisierte Mikrocontroller mit erweiterten Sicherheitsmerkmalen und Zertifizierungen erforderlich.
